Daimler-Chrysler is recalling about 180,000 vehicles.
The call back includes 145,000 Dodge Ram, light duty pick-up trucks.
Officials say they're being recalled to replace the passenger air bags.
More than 15,000 of the same model trucks are being recalled to fix the front passenger seat belt assembly.
Meantime, about 35,000 Dodge Durangos are also being called in to check their console wiring connectors.
Overall, Chrysler has had almost 20 recalls this year covering more than two million cars and trucks.
